Iron ore is any rock or mineral from which iron can economically be extracted. It comes in a variety of colors, including dark gray, bright yellow, deep purple, and rusty red. The iron comes in the form of iron oxides such as magnetite, hematite, limonite, goethite, or siderite. Economically viable forms of ore contain between 25% and 60% iron.

2020-8-15 · Iron Production. The production of iron from its ore involves an oxidation-reduction reaction carried out in a blast furnace. Iron ore is usually a mixture of iron and vast quantities of impurities such as sand and clay referred to as gangue. The iron found in iron ores are found in the form of iron oxides. 2008-11-16 · Deferoxamine (DFO) is a high affinity Fe (III) chelator produced by Streptomyces pilosus that is used clinically to remove systemic iron in secondary iron overload disorders. 2002-2-15 · The body needs some replacement iron to make red blood cells. Dietary iron is OK, even from meat. Only 5 percent of iron in plant foods is available, vs. 30 to 50 percent of iron from meat. 13 Meat is not the culprit, it is the lack of molecules in the diet that control iron that makes iron a rusting agent (see below).

The extracted material was subsequently subjected to acid digestion and to a miniaturized chromatographic procedure for isolation of Fe from the blood matrix. The Fe isotopic compositions and concentrations of paired finger-prick and venous blood samples collected at the same time from six individuals were compared.
